Foundations of stochastic time-dependent current-density functional theory for open quantum systems: Potential pitfalls and rigorous results
We clarify some misunderstandings on the time-dependent current-density functional theory for open quantum systems we have recently introduced [M.DiVentra and R. D’Agosta, Phys.Rev.Lett. 98, 226403 (2007)]. We also show that some of the recent formulations attempting to improve on this theory suffer from some inconsistencies, especially in establishing the mapping between the external potential and the quantities of interest. We offer a general argument about this mapping, which applies to any density functional theory, showing that it must fulfill certain “dimensionality” requirements.
